Technical field
This utility model relates to coal mine equipment field, a kind of adjustable support muscle for hydraulic support welding.
Background technology
Hydraulic support is the important support apparatus of colliery fully-mechanized coalface, its key component has base, back timber, caving shield tail boom and hydraulic jack etc., each parts fitted position requires higher, to ensure during general assembly that each parts are installed bearing pin and interted flexibly, it is ensured that support serviceability and overall performance.The base of hydraulic support is usually the box typed structure become by Plate Welding, structure is complicated, welding capacity is big, weld size is difficult to ensure, owing to the quality of steel plate self strengthens, the welding process between steel plate and steel plate easily occurs welding deformation, therefore, the guarantee of welding quality and the control of welding deformation are hydraulic support entirety and the key of local quality control, are also the support most important things made in one piece.In the welding procedure of existing factory site hydraulic support, the welding process of hydraulic support foundation typically requires the frock using each parts with composition bracket base to match and carries out the auxiliary positioning of each parts, or utilize the scale instrument matched to carry out the location of concrete size, then each parts are subjected to the most one by one, to ensure that welding is sized to be maintained in range of error between each parts after completing, reduce the inconvenience of the follow-up many installations brought because of size welding error as far as possible.But the positioning welding mode of each parts of this hydraulic support foundation still suffers from bigger problem: the frock of these parts of auxiliary positioning is all the structure of pedestal class, will be temporarily fixed in pedestal by bracket base parts, between the bottom of parts or bracket base steel plate, size immobilizes to a certain extent, but the size between steel plate top can not be fixed, in welding process, the interim fixing steel plate in bottom there will be inclination more or less unavoidably, cause the size between steel plate top that bigger error occurs, the plate size error welded in this case is bigger, the installation dimension demand of base can not be met.

Detailed description of the invention
Elaborating this utility model below in conjunction with specific embodiment, the present embodiment, premised on technical solutions of the utility model, gives detailed embodiment and concrete operating process.
As shown in the figure, this utility model is a kind of adjustable support muscle for hydraulic support welding, including sleeve 1 and the screw rod I 2 and the screw rod II 3 that are threaded in sleeve 1 two ends, described screw rod I 2 is contrary with the hand of spiral of screw rod II 3, the free end of screw rod I 2 connects gripper shoe 4, the free end of screw rod II 3 connects clamping device, this clamping device is made up of the fixed plate 5 be arrangeding in parallel and grip block 6 and the stud 7 that is vertically located on fixed plate 5 and grip block 6, described fixed plate 5 is fixed on the free end of screw rod II 3, stud 7 is equipped with several for the cushion block 9 regulating gripper mechanism grips width on the cylinder between fixed plate 5 and grip block 6.
It is more than a basic embodiment of the present utility model, can be improved further, optimize or limit on the basis of above.
Further, described sleeve 1 one end is connected with screw rod II 3 by stop nut 10.
Support muscle described in the utility model is when reality is applied, the clamping device that screw rod II free end is fixed plays a part to support and load-and pressure-bearing, especially when being to apply weld at large-sized hydraulic support foundation when support muscle, the bearing length by support muscle is needed to regulate to desired location, now, threaded length by extremely limited for two between screw rod with sleeve, the bearing capacity of two screw rod particularly screw rods II will be affected with the steadiness of support, therefore, at screwing position between sleeve and screw rod II, stop nut is set, increase the length of threadeding between screw rod II and sleeve, increase the steadiness connecting with supporting.
Further, described sleeve 1 be positioned on the barrel wall at center be provided with for gripper sleeve 1 so that its rotate holding tank 101.
The setting of holding tank 101 more has personnel convenient to operate to utilize machine tool manually to regulate the bearing length of support muscle.
Further, the length of described fixed plate 5 is more than the length of grip block 6, and fixed plate 5 is fixed on the free end of screw rod II 3, fixed plate 5 and the grip block 6 vertical stud 7 being equipped with two horizontal parallel in position near top at bottom.
Further, the body of rod of described screw rod I 2 being provided with for clamping screw rod I 2 so that its groove 201 rotated, the effect with holding tank 101 is identical, and groove 201 operator that are more convenient for utilize the extension elongation of machine tool manual adjusting screw rod I relative sleeve 1.
This utility model is when reality is applied:
Simulated by software, calculate the size in the power suffered by welding process support muscle, thus calculate the concrete size of the support each parts of muscle further.Because the size of support muscle institute's stress and moment mainly with the height of main muscle and crotch away from size relevant, therefore according to this, support can be classified.After determining the size of each parts, processing several groups, and put in actual production, can the structure of checking screw thread bear deformation force during structural member welding.
